What Is a Virtual Wedding Certificate?
A virtual wedding certificate is a digital document that officially records the marriage between two individuals. It is typically issued by government authorities or authorized wedding platforms, especially in cases where the marriage occurs online or in a virtual setting. These certificates serve as legal proof of marriage and are often used for various official purposes, such as visa applications, social security benefits, or personal records.
What Constitutes a Fake Wedding Certificate?
A fake wedding certificate, in the context of virtual documentation, is any document that falsely claims to be an official record of a marriage but is either:
- Illegally fabricated, forged, or counterfeit
- Altered or manipulated to misrepresent the marriage status
- Obtained through fraudulent means without the actual marriage taking place
Fake certificates can be created using sophisticated graphic design tools, scanned images of genuine documents, or entirely fabricated templates. They may look convincing but lack the authenticity and official validation needed to be considered legally valid.

How to Identify a Fake Virtual Wedding Certificate
Detecting counterfeit wedding certificates requires careful scrutiny and awareness of common signs of forgery. Here are some key indicators:
Visual Inspection
- Check for inconsistencies in fonts, spacing, or formatting
- Look for spelling mistakes or grammatical errors
- Examine the quality of printing or digital resolution
Verification Features
- Official seals, stamps, or holograms that are difficult to replicate
- QR codes or barcodes that can be scanned for authenticity
- Digital signatures or encryption embedded in electronic documents
Cross-Checking with Issuing Authority
- Contact the issuing agency directly to verify the document
- Use official online verification portals or databases
- Confirm details such as date, names, and registration numbers
Examining Metadata and Document Properties
- Review the document’s metadata for editing history
- Check for inconsistencies in timestamps or version history
- Use forensic tools to detect alterations or manipulations

Preventive Measures and Solutions
For Individuals
- Always request official documents from recognized authorities
- Verify the authenticity of certificates before submission
- Keep digital copies of original documents in secure locations
For Organizations and Authorities
- Implement secure verification systems, such as blockchain or digital signatures
- Use watermarks, holograms, or other anti-counterfeiting features
- Educate staff and the public about common signs of fake documents
- Establish clear protocols for document verification and validation
Technological Innovations
- Use of QR codes linked to official databases
- Blockchain-based certification systems for tamper-proof records
- Digital signatures and encryption to enhance security
- AI-powered tools for detecting forgeries
